What companies run services between Chesterton, Porter County, IN, USA and Champaign, IL, USA?

You can take a vehicle from Chesterton to Champaign-Urbana via Dune Park, 55th - 56th - 57th St., and Homewood in around 4h 43m. Alternatively, Flixbus USA operates a bus from Chicago to Champaign Intermodal Trans Ctr twice daily. Tickets cost $24–65 and the journey takes 2h 20m.
